The Catalina 36 was designed by Frank Butler as the perfect family cruiser. It's well known for outstanding performance under sail with comfortable accommodations and a secure workable deck plan. In today's world, the Catalina 36 remains one of the best values in her size range.


Vela spent many years in the freshwater Great Lakes. She was then moved to the Gulf coast of Florida.


Included in the sale is a Walker Bay 8 Ft Dinghy with 3 HP Outboard and oars

The Biggest Pros and Cons

The 1984 Catalina 36 is a popular sailboat known for its balance of performance, comfort, and affordability. Here are some pros and cons to consider:

Pros

Spacious Interior: The Catalina 36 features a well-designed interior with plenty of headroom, a roomy salon, and a functional galley, making it ideal for extended cruising or living aboard.

Sturdy Build: Known for their durability, the Catalina 36 was constructed with high-quality materials and workmanship, ensuring longevity and reliability on the water.

User-Friendly Sailing: This sailboat is designed for ease of handling, making it suitable for both beginners and experienced sailors. Its manageable size and sail plan allow for enjoyable sailing in various conditions.

Versatile Layout: The Catalina 36 offers different layout options, including a choice between two or three cabins, catering to different preferences and needs.

Good Performance: With a moderate keel and a well-balanced rig, the Catalina 36 provides solid performance under sail, making it a reliable companion for both coastal cruising and longer passages.

Strong Community: As a popular model, there’s a vibrant community of Catalina 36 owners, which can be a great resource for support, advice, and parts.

Cons

Older Model: Being from 1984, many Catalina 36s may require updates or renovations, especially in terms of electronics, rigging, and plumbing, which could entail additional costs.

Limited Storage: While the interior is spacious, some users find that storage space can be somewhat limited, particularly for longer voyages or for those with ample gear.

Not a High-Performance Cruiser: While the Catalina 36 performs well for recreational sailing, it may not be the best choice for those seeking high-performance racing or very fast cruising capabilities.

Draft Considerations: The draft of the Catalina 36 can be a downside for shallow water cruising, limiting access to certain harbors or anchorages.

Maintenance Needs: As with any older vessel, the condition of the boat largely depends on how well it has been maintained. Potential buyers should budget for inspections and possible refurbishments.
